Go to G-Helper github and you will pretty much get everything. Just launch the AC uninstalled tool and then restart the PC, uninstall the other ASUS Monitor software that conflicts with G-Helper which is mentioned on the Github. You can uninstall myAsus if you want (I did) and then download the G-Helper app from Github, place it under C:\Program Files\ and create a G-Helper folder. Launch it and make sure to select the “Run on start up” check box.
Regarding battery, you can select the 80% limit for health, or limit the CPU wattage for better endurance.
I suggest leaving the GPU in standard to connect your monitor and use Eco when unplugged. Good luck!
